How does that work? If you use a different e-mail address, different names and basically a totally different account, how can they know to ban all of them? Would that mean that no one else in the family could play under their characters? because typically it is the same thing.

All I am saying is that besides our e-mail addresses and any other info we put into VMK, I'm sure that staff also logs our IP addresses as well. If a person makes 50 mules in one day, all logging them in on the same computer one after another, every IP address for those accounts would be the same. All I am saying is that if VMK were to impose a rule about limiting the number of mules that each person creates, they would have a way to monitor the situation when it comes to where each account is logging in and when.

Just another thing that I've heard: You can make up a completely fake e-mail address for your account BUT for the title to be approved and the account to still function after a while, the e-mail address must exist somewhere. However, not necessarily an e-mail address owned by you. The problem with that is if by some crazy coincidence a person with the same e-mail address that you put into make the mule decided to make a VMK account, they would not be able to since the e-mail is already taken. All I am saying is, be cautious if you were to make dozens of dozens of mules because VMK is always watching.... :)

You can use a gibberish e-mail since you don't need to go to that e-mail address to confirm anything.

The only drawback to using a gibberish e-mail is if something should happen to your character (ie: bad trade, bugs, etc.), you won't be able to report it. Well, you could report it if you remembered all the details you inputted when you created your mule, but VMK would not be able to respond back to you. I was trading something to myself one time, when the trade window crashed and I lost my item. Luckily, I always use a valid e-mail addresss when I create mules, so VMK was able to get back to me regarding my issue.
